At OneMain, our Auto Loan Representatives in the auto purchase department serve as the initial contact for customers acquiring a vehicle. They help customers complete the financing of a vehicle through a local dealership while working closely with the dealership’s sales agents, in a call center environment. They communicate with dealers, merchants, and customers in handling the appropriate products or services OneMain offers by listening and understanding their financial situation. Our Auto Loan Representatives in the auto purchase department exercise good judgment and discretion to facilitate business decisions, have strong product knowledge and drive for results, multitask, and have excellent time management skills.

OneMain Financial (NYSE: OMF) is the leader in offering nonprime customers responsible access to credit and is dedicated to improving the financial well-being of hardworking Americans. Since 1912, we’ve looked beyond credit scores to help people get the money they need today and reach their goals for tomorrow. Our growing suite of personal loans, credit cards and other products help people borrow better and work toward a brighter future.
